Ray Hardee

Ray Hardee
CEO & Chief Engineer

One of the principal founders of Engineered Software, Ray Hardee is also Co-Owner and Chief Engineer. Starting in 1982 Hardee was chiefly responsible for engineering and sales for Engineered Software. Prior to establishing Engineered Software, Hardee had over 13 years in the power generation industry. Hardee graduated with Honors from the United States Merchant Marine Academy in Kings Point, NY. Upon graduation, Hardee became an officer in the U.S. Naval Nuclear Power program and qualified submarines.

After the Navy, Hardee worked for Ebasco Services, and was involved in the start-up and test group where he would perform the pre-operational tests for both nuclear and fossil power plants. Hardee has contributed dozens of articles and papers to various magazines and standards publications and has given over a thousand presentations on fluid piping around the world.

 
Carolyn Popp

Carolyn Popp
President & Chief Technical Officer

Principal, Co-Owner and Chief Technical Officer, Carolyn Popp has been with Engineered Software, Inc. since 1982. First holding the positions of Developer, Support, and maintaining financials of the company, Popp has been one of the driving forces in Engineered Software’s success. Popp received her Bachelor’s in Mathematics from Saint Bonaventure University in Olean, NY. She received her minor in Physics, graduating cum laude, and was first in her department.

Popp’s previous experience stems from her three years as a software developer for Pfizer Pharmaceuticals. Before then she worked as a Software Engineer at Aerojet Nuclear and spent over two years as a Systems Engineer for IBM.

 
Michael Blondin

Michael Blondin
Chief Operating Officer
Michael Blondin began with Engineered Software in 2005 as Marketing Manager, with over nine years of experience in marketing and sales. Blondin holds a B.A. in Political Science from Western Washington University and a M.B.A. from the Kogod School of Business, American University in Washington, D.C. Most recently Blondin held a senior marketing management position at the Tacoma Regional Convention and Visitors Bureau in Tacoma, WA.

Blondin draws from his experiences in sales and marketing roles at True Careers, an Internet based start-up within Sallie Mae, Inc. in Reston, VA and at Aristotle International, a political technology company in Washington, D.C. Blondin also served as a Legislative Aide to Congressman Brian Baird in Washington, D.C.

 
Zac Vawter

Zac Vawter
Vice President of Programming

Hired in 2002 by Engineered Software, Zac Vawter became a full time software developer upon completing his Bachelors of Science degree in Computer Science. Vawter obtained a BS in Computer Science from Saint Martin’s University, in Lacey Washington. Prior to working for Engineered Software, Inc., Vawter had four years of software development experience as the Assistant Network Administrator for Saint Martin’s University.

 

Christy Bermensolo
Vice President of Engineering

Christy Bermensolo came to Engineered Software in 2006 as an Application Engineer, bringing over nine years of previous engineering experience. Bermensolo earned her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ering from the University of New Mexico, in Albuquerque, New Mexico. She received her EIT (Engineer in Training) certification in 1998 and began her nine years of employment with the Intel Corporation in DuPont, Washington.

Bermensolo rising through the ranks to the position of Senior Mechanical Engineer while employed first in the Enterprise Server Group, then the Desktop Platforms Group and later in the User-Centered Platform Solutions Division with Intel Corp. During this time, Bermensolo also earned a patent for the Connector for Printed Circuit Boards (#6,146,176), a mechanism used to assist the assembly of high force connectors. Bermensolo later presented at the 2006 Spring Intel Developers Conference on the design & analysis of the thermal-mechanical solution for the Intel 945G Express Chipset. Rounding out her notable presentations is the “BTX Platforms,” for the ASME Puget Sound Section.

Bermensolo draws on her nine years of previous management and engineering experience with the Intel Corporation, and her leadership as a NCAA, Division I Swimming Team Captain, and PSIA Level 1 Ski Instructor. She has presented a variety of training courses for Engineered Software, Inc. as well as researched, designed and created the PIPE-FLO Verification and Validation study to support certifications within the nuclear industry.
